The Egyptian angelfish is fertile. Next, let's take a look at the breeding aspects of Egyptian angelfish!

1. During the breeding period of Egyptian angelfish, there should only be one pair of Egyptian angelfish in each breeding tank. Generally, the Egyptian angelfish needs to live in soft water with a pH value of 4.5~5.5 and a water temperature of 27°C. Do not change the water on the first day, and only change about 5cm of new water once a day.
